Calix held its 2022 Partner Innovations Awards at ConneXions 2022, honoring partners for exceptional contributions to broadband service delivery. Key awards included:
- Partner of the Year: GLDS for innovative integration.
- Strategic Partnership Award: Conexon for excellence with service providers.
- Partner Impact Award: Vantage Point Solutions for securing $3 billion in funding.
- Partner Innovation Award: Camvio for delivering rapid proof of concepts.
- Market Activation Partner Award: Pivot for cutting campaign launch times by 60%.
- Training Achievement Award: JSI for completing the most training.
Calix, Inc. (NYSE: CALX) celebrated the winners of its annual Customer Innovations Awards during ConneXions 2022, honoring broadband service providers (BSPs) for their outstanding achievements. Awardees showcased innovations that set them apart in competitive markets, achieving a Net Promoter Score (NPS) nearly three times the industry average. Notable winners include Mt. Horeb Telephone Company for marketing, YK Communications for customer support, and AcenTek for sustainability, displaying significant efficiency and growth improvements while contributing to community development.
Calix, Inc. (NYSE:CALX) has unveiled the GigaSpire® BLAST u4hm, a robust outdoor Wi-Fi 6 mesh system designed to enhance its Revenue EDGE platform. This new system delivers high-bandwidth services to various outdoor locations, boosting subscriber satisfaction and loyalty. It simplifies deployment for broadband service providers (BSPs) by integrating seamlessly with Calix Support Cloud, thereby reducing operational expenses (OPEX). Additionally, the GigaSpire BLAST u4hm supports SmartTown deployment, expanding market reach and innovative IoT applications for BSPs.
Calix, in collaboration with Antietam Broadband, achieved a milestone by executing the industry's first live network upgrade without downtime using the Calix Intelligent Access EDGE™ platform. The upgrade was completed in under 10 minutes per OLT, leading to a 60% reduction in labor costs and eliminating subscriber interruptions. This innovative capability allows for future upgrades to be automated, enhancing efficiency and reducing operational expenses. The success underscores Calix's commitment to innovation in broadband service delivery.
Calix has enhanced its Support Cloud platform with new automation features, an AI-enabled chatbot, and improved subscriber experience analytics. These advancements aim to assist broadband service providers (BSPs) in delivering proactive and efficient customer support. The updates support BSPs in adapting to evolving subscriber habits and competition, allowing even smaller providers to offer differentiated managed services. This proactive support strategy is designed to elevate customer satisfaction and drive higher Net Promoter Scores (NPS).
Calix (NYSE: CALX) has launched its Business Insights Services to aid broadband service providers (BSPs) in enhancing their data analytics capabilities. This service aims to convert raw data from the Calix Cloud and other sources into actionable plans, starting with Net Promoter Score (NPS) analysis. The initiative is part of Calix's strategy to support BSPs in navigating intense competition by developing differentiated managed services. Key benefits include improved subscriber relationships and tailored marketing strategies to drive revenue growth.
Calix has launched Marketing Cloud Plus, a groundbreaking subscriber engagement solution for broadband service providers (BSPs). This platform enriches subscriber insights using demographic, psychographic, and geographic data to enhance marketing ROI. According to a 2022 survey, 65% of broadband executives prioritize subscriber acquisition and upselling for growth. The new platform supports BSPs by enabling targeted campaigns and increased average revenue per user (ARPU). Calix's recent enhancements also include four new managed services, expanding their ecosystem to 11 offerings.
Calix recently announced at Calix ConneXions 2022 the introduction of its 8th to 11th managed services, expanding its offerings to broadband service providers (BSPs).
As the global broadband services market is expected to double in the coming decade, these additions aim to enhance BSPs' capabilities in reaching new markets and providing exceptional experiences to subscribers.
Calix has invested over $1 billion in its platforms over the past 11 years, facilitating rapid innovation for service providers.
Calix (NYSE: CALX) has launched HomeOfficeIQ, its 11th managed service aimed at enhancing connectivity for work-from-home subscribers. This new service provides seamless network resiliency through cellular backup, ensuring automatic failover and continuity for essential work devices. With over half of U.S. job holders working from home, this innovation aims to reduce service disruptions and improve subscriber retention for Broadband Service Providers (BSPs). The announcement was made at the Calix ConneXions 2022 conference in Las Vegas.
Calix, Inc. (NYSE: CALX) has expanded its partnership with Arlo, introducing a fully managed home protection service integrated into the Calix Revenue EDGE platform. This addition, Arlo Security, aims to empower broadband service providers (BSPs) to stand out in competitive markets. Key features include responsive security monitoring and advanced sensors. With only 36% of American households equipped with home security systems, this initiative presents significant market potential. Arlo Security is set to be available to BSPs in early 2023, enhancing customer relationships and potentially increasing average revenue per user.
